The Museum of Chinese History
With a floor space of 8,000 square metres, the Museum of Chinese History has permanent exhibitions covering important occasions in Chinese history, a period from 1.7 million years ago in the primitive period down to 1919—the May 4 th Movement . Among the 300,000 precious treasures, the stoneware, bronze works and ancient currencies are the most famous. Many of the 230,000 volumes of books stored here are the only copies in the world. The building was constructed in 1958 and completed in 1959, with a total floor space of 65,000 square metres. It falls into four parts, and we are going to show you the major exhibits. |
